Overview of Medox (ANTIBACTERIALS)

Quick Facts

Property Description
Active ingredient Doxycycline
Form Capsule, Tablet (Systemic Oral)
Pharmacological class Tetracycline Antibiotic
Prescription Status Prescription-only (Rx)
Origin Semisynthetic

What is Medox? Defining the Doxycycline Antibiotic Class and Identity

Medox is a prescription-only systemic medicine classified as a broad-spectrum antibiotic that belongs to the tetracycline group, with the active component being Doxycycline. This medication is designed to act internally throughout the body to manage bacterial infections. Doxycycline is designated as a semisynthetic compound, derived from the natural tetracycline structure, which provides enhanced stability and efficacy compared to earlier agents. This agent is often utilized in scenarios where a sustained systemic approach is required, making it distinct from topical or localized antimicrobials.

Composition and Forms for Systemic Action

The medicinal entity Medox is a single-active ingredient product where the core component is Doxycycline, typically presented as its salt forms, such as Doxycycline hyclate or Doxycycline monohydrate, for optimized absorption. Medox is primarily available as solid oral dosage forms, specifically capsules or tablets, intended for systemic administration by mouth. The purpose of this oral route is to ensure the active antibacterial compound is absorbed into the bloodstream, enabling it to reach therapeutic concentrations in various internal tissues crucial for fighting widespread infections.

General Purpose: How Doxycycline Fights Bacterial Growth

The general purpose of Medox is to manage and resolve infections by stopping the growth and spread of susceptible bacteria across the body. Doxycycline achieves this by exerting a bacteriostatic action, which means it works by inhibiting the bacterial cell’s ability to create essential proteins needed for multiplication. The key mechanism is stopping the bacteria from growing and reproducing, thereby assisting the body's natural immune system in clearing the remaining bacterial population and controlling the infection. What side effects are possible with Medox (ANTIBACTERIALS)?

Possible Side Effects and Safety Information

The safety profile of Medox (Doxycycline) describes possible adverse reactions grouped by frequency and the body system affected, consistent with official regulatory labeling. These reactions range from Common and expected effects to Rare but serious concerns documented in government prescribing information.


Adverse Reaction Classifications

Classification Examples of Documented Adverse Reactions
Common Nausea, vomiting, diarrhea, headache, photosensitivity reaction (exaggerated sunburn-like response).
Uncommon Hypersensitivity reactions (e.g., urticaria, angioedema, anaphylactic reaction).
Rare Increased intracranial pressure (pseudotumor cerebri), hepatotoxicity, pancreatitis, thrombocytopenia.

Serious Safety Concerns and Restrictions

Official regulatory documents identify certain adverse events as serious or clinically significant. These include Pseudomembranous Colitis (due to C. difficile overgrowth) and Severe Cutaneous Adverse Reactions (SCARs), such as Stevens-Johnson Syndrome (SJS).

Population-Specific Constraint: The medicine is generally contraindicated in children under 8 years of age. Use in this group during tooth development carries the risk of permanent tooth discoloration (yellow-gray-brown) and enamel hypoplasia. This is a fundamental restriction in the official safety profile.

Exposure-Related Patterns: Safety notes link specific reactions to contextual factors. For instance, esophagitis or esophageal ulceration may be associated with taking the oral form immediately before lying down or with insufficient fluid. Photosensitivity requires avoidance of sun exposure during treatment to prevent an exaggerated skin reaction.

Overdose and Emergency Response

Overdose and When to Seek Help

Official regulatory information describes Medox (Doxycycline) overdose primarily as an increased incidence of known side effects. Manifestations typically involve nausea, vomiting, diarrhea, anorexia, and dermatologic reactions like photosensitivity or rash.


Serious Outcomes and Urgent Actions

Official labeling warns of the potential for rare, serious complications resulting from excessive systemic exposure. These include the risk of Pseudotumor Cerebri (Benign Intracranial Hypertension), characterized by severe headache or vision changes, which requires an immediate ophthalmologic evaluation. Overdose may also increase the risk of liver injury.

For any suspected overdose, government guidance mandates you contact a Poison Control Center or emergency room at once. Call emergency services immediately if the person has collapsed, had a seizure, has trouble breathing, or can't be awakened.


Management and Considerations

Treatment is defined by regulatory bodies as strictly symptomatic and supportive. There is no specific antidote known for Doxycycline overdose. Management procedures may include reducing absorption via gastric lavage or administration of activated charcoal, with the notable statement that dialysis is ineffective for drug clearance. Patients with renal impairment are flagged for caution due to the risk of excessive systemic accumulation.

What should I know about interactions with other medicines?

Interactions with Medicines and Products

The regulatory interaction profile for Medox (Doxycycline) outlines specific combinations and administration conditions documented in official labeling.

Contraindicated Combinations and Restrictions Co-administration of Medox with oral retinoids (such as Isotretinoin) is restricted due to the officially documented risk of Pseudotumor Cerebri (Benign Intracranial Hypertension). The concurrent use of Medox with the anesthetic Methoxyflurane is also restricted based on reports of fatal renal toxicity. It is officially advised to avoid giving Medox with penicillin as the bacteriostatic action may interfere with the bactericidal effect.

Exposure-Altering Pharmacokinetic Patterns Medicines that are known enzyme inducers, including Phenytoin, Carbamazepine, and Phenobarbital, have been documented to decrease the half-life of Doxycycline, resulting in reduced systemic exposure. Chronic ingestion of alcohol is also officially reported to decrease the half-life of Doxycycline.

Absorption and Timing Rules The absorption of Medox is impaired by agents containing multivalent cations. This includes antacids, iron preparations, and Bismuth Subsalicylate. To manage this chelation-based pharmacokinetic interaction, these products must be administered separately from Medox by a window of at least two to three hours. Furthermore, Medox may depress plasma prothrombin activity; patients on oral anticoagulants may require a corresponding downward adjustment of their anticoagulant dosage, as stated in regulatory documents.

Mechanism of Action

The Dual Mechanism of Medox (Doxycycline)

Medox, with the active component Doxycycline, exerts its physiological effect through a distinct dual mechanism that induces the cessation of bacterial proliferation and modulates host inflammatory pathways.


Bacteriostasis: Halting Protein Synthesis

This domain covers the primary biological targets and core molecular action that impedes bacterial replication. The drug selectively binds to the bacterial 30S ribosomal subunit , preventing the binding of aminoacyl-tRNA required for protein chain elongation. This action results in the arrest of bacterial protein synthesis, thereby causing bacterial growth arrest (bacteriostasis).


Host Modulation: Effects on Tissue-Degrading Enzymes

This secondary mechanistic domain involves the drug's effect on host physiological processes, independent of its antibacterial action. Doxycycline acts as a modulator by suppressing the activity of specific host enzymes, notably Matrix Metalloproteinases (MMPs), and affecting the signaling of pro-inflammatory cells. This activity results in the suppression of excessive host tissue catabolism and affects signaling patterns within host inflammatory pathways.

Dosage and Administration Information

How to Use Medox (ANTIBACTERIALS)

Medox, containing the active ingredient Doxycycline, is administered systemically via the oral route (capsules or tablets) or intravenously (IV) in certain clinical scenarios. The selection of route and dosage form is determined by the healthcare provider based on the clinical context.


Official Dosing and Frequency Patterns

The standard protocol for adult use begins with a loading dose of 200 mg on the first day of treatment, which may be given as a single amount or divided into two 100 mg doses. Following the initial dose, the typical maintenance dose is 100 mg administered once daily (QD). For the management of certain severe infections, the official dose may be increased to 200 mg every twelve hours. The total duration of therapy is variable but often ranges from 7 to 14 days.


Administration Requirements

Oral doses must be taken with a full glass of water to ensure proper passage through the esophagus. Patients are instructed to remain in an upright position (sitting or standing) for at least 30 minutes after taking the capsule or tablet. The medicine may be taken with or without food. If the intravenous route is used, the powder must be properly reconstituted and then slowly infused over a period of 1 to 4 hours.


Population-Specific Use

For pediatric patients over eight years old, dosing is weight-based, typically starting at 4.4 mg/kg of body weight followed by a maintenance dose of 2.2 mg/kg daily. Uniquely among many tetracyclines, no dosage adjustment is typically required for patients with impaired kidney function.

Frequently Asked Questions (FAQ)

Common questions about Medox (ANTIBACTERIALS) (FAQ)

Q: What kind of infections does Medox treat?

A: Medox (Doxycycline) is a broad-spectrum antibiotic officially indicated for the treatment of various bacterial infections. This includes specific types of sexually transmitted infections (STIs), infections of the respiratory tract, and certain tick-borne illnesses, such as rickettsial infections. The specific infection being treated dictates the official dosing protocol.

Q: How quickly does Medox start to work?

A: Official drug information indicates that Doxycycline typically begins to inhibit bacterial growth within 24 to 48 hours of the first dose. However, the exact time it takes for a person to notice symptom relief can vary widely. Symptom improvement depends on the specific infection being treated and the body's individual response.

Q: What happens if I stop taking Medox early?

A: Regulatory warnings state that the prescribed course of Medox should be completed in its entirety, even if symptoms improve sooner. Stopping early is associated with the potential for the infection to return and may contribute to the development of drug-resistant bacteria (AMR).

Q: Can Medox make birth control pills less effective?

A: Regulatory documents state that Doxycycline may reduce the effectiveness of some oral contraceptives (birth control pills) in some women. Official documentation advises that all individuals on oral contraceptives consult a healthcare provider regarding the need for additional or alternative forms of contraception during treatment.

Q: Is Medox the same drug as [Similar Antibiotic Name]?

A: Medox contains the active ingredient Doxycycline, which is classified as a tetracycline-class antibiotic. Other medicines may contain different active components and belong to other classes, such as penicillins or macrolides. Therefore, Medox is not the same as antibiotics from a different drug class.

Q: What is the difference between Medox and other antibacterials?

A: Medox is noted for having a dual mechanism of action. Its primary action is bacteriostatic, meaning it works by stopping bacteria from growing. Separately, official research notes it has a secondary effect that reduces certain types of inflammation and tissue breakdown in the body.

Q: What research has been done on Medox for long-term use?

A: Long-term use of Doxycycline is approved for specific conditions, such as malaria prophylaxis, for up to four months. Official documents state that information on the sustained impact on the body’s overall microbiome after extended use is still being studied. The long-term use of this medicine requires ongoing monitoring by a healthcare provider.

Q: Is Medox known to cause tendon problems?

A: Tendon problems, such as tendinitis or tendon rupture, are generally associated with a different family of antibiotics known as fluoroquinolones. Official regulatory documents classify Medox as a tetracycline and do not list this specific risk in its safety information.

Q: Is Medox appropriate for treating skin infections?

A: Yes, Medox is officially indicated for treating certain skin and soft tissue infections caused by susceptible bacteria. It is also frequently used as an adjunctive therapy (in addition to other treatments) for conditions like severe acne.

Q: Can Medox be used for ear infections in adults?

A: Doxycycline is indicated for the treatment of certain upper respiratory tract infections. Official use is determined by the specific organism causing the infection, as diagnosed by a healthcare provider.

Q: Are there generic versions of Medox available?

A: Yes, the active ingredient in Medox, Doxycycline, is widely available in generic formulations. These generic forms contain the same active ingredient and are subject to regulatory standards that address quality and equivalence.

Q: Does Medox have a black box warning from the FDA?

A: No, the FDA has not assigned a Boxed Warning (commonly called a Black Box Warning) to Doxycycline. However, the regulatory label does contain serious warnings and precautions regarding its use in specific populations, such as children and pregnant women.

Q: What if I miss a dose of Medox?

A: If a dose of Medox is missed, patient information advises taking it as soon as you remember. If it is almost time for the next scheduled dose, the missed dose should be skipped entirely. Official information states that taking two doses at the same time to compensate for a missed dose is not recommended.

Q: What is the evidence for Medox treating chronic conditions?

A: Medox has formal approval for managing certain chronic conditions like severe acne and rosacea that require long-term management. These uses often involve specific low-dose regimens. Official information does not consistently support its use for other types of chronic conditions.

Q: Is there a maximum amount of time a person can use Medox?

A: The duration of use depends on the medical reason for which it is prescribed. Official labeling notes the maximum approved duration is up to four months for conditions like malaria prevention. For other infections, official guidance indicates the duration is variable based on the clinical context.

Q: What is the shelf life of Medox tablets?

A: Official drug labeling requires Medox to be used before the expiration date printed on the packaging. If the product is stored under the correct conditions, it should maintain quality until that date. Any product past the expiration date must be safely discarded according to official disposal instructions.

Q: What are the common signs of an allergic reaction to Medox?

A: Signs of a potentially serious allergic reaction may include skin issues like a rash or hives (urticaria), swelling of the face, tongue, or throat (angioedema), and difficulty breathing. Official documents indicate these symptoms are serious and necessitate prompt professional medical evaluation.

Q: Can people with diabetes use Medox?

A: Official regulatory labeling does not list diabetes as a formal contraindication to using Doxycycline. It is necessary that all individuals with a pre-existing health condition, including diabetes, have their full medical history reviewed by a healthcare provider prior to starting this treatment.

Q: Can Medox interact with certain vitamins or supplements?

A: Yes, Medox interacts with supplements that contain multivalent cations (positively charged metal ions), such as iron preparations, calcium, and zinc. These supplements must be separated from Medox administration by at least 2 to 3 hours to prevent reduced absorption of the antibiotic.

Q: Does the time of day matter when taking Medox?

A: For regimens that require taking the medicine once daily, patient information generally advises taking it at the same time each day to maintain consistent levels in the body. If prescribed twice daily, it is often suggested to space the doses approximately 12 hours apart.

Q: Can you build up a tolerance to Medox over time?

A: From a medical perspective, this concern relates to Antimicrobial Resistance (AMR). Regulatory documents emphasize that Medox should only be used as indicated to reduce the development of drug-resistant bacteria. Resistance makes the antibiotic less effective over time against certain bacterial strains.

Q: What does the patient leaflet say about driving while using Medox?

A: Doxycycline is not commonly known to impair the ability to drive or operate machinery. However, official warnings advise that caution should be exercised if an individual experiences certain side effects, such as dizziness or severe headaches. If these effects occur, official safety notes suggest that caution be exercised regarding driving or operating machinery.

How should Medox (ANTIBACTERIALS) be stored and disposed of?

Official Storage and Disposal Requirements

Regulatory documentation defines specific rules for storing and disposing of Medox to maintain its quality and ensure safety. The product must be stored at Controlled Room Temperature, which is 20°C to 25°C (68°F to 77°F), with temporary excursions allowed between 15°C and 30°C (59°F and 86°F). It is required to keep the medication in its original, tightly closed container and to protect it from moisture and excessive heat. The medication must not be frozen.

For stability, official labeling instructs users to discard any unused portion 14 days after opening the container. For security and safety, the medication must be stored out of reach of children and pets. Disposal of expired or unwanted Medox should be done through an authorized medicine take-back program or by following specific official disposal instructions. Do not flush the medication down a toilet or pour it down a drain.
